Brown Bag Lunch w/ FREE workshop by Gail Sussman Miller!
Friday, April 27, 2007
12:00 pm to 1:30 pm

Forum on the River, 10 S. Riverside Plaza, Suite 800, Chicago, IL 60606


Brown Bag Career Mapping Lunch

FREE EVENT but RSVP is required.

Join us on April 27 for a Brown Bag Lunch and a transformational FREE workshop!

Gail Sussman Miller of Inspired Choice presents

"How to Love Networking for Association Professionals" 

Are you an association professional who…

·         Knows that networking is a powerful way to help you reach your careers goals and yet hates the thought of going to networking events and walking into a room full of strangers?

·         Doesn't know what to say, hates small talk, or is uncomfortable starting conversations?

·         Worries about being interesting or experienced enough to contribute to conversation?

·         Doesn't want to be pushy, force a sales pitch or appear to be out to "get" something?

·         Think you don't know the right techniques or have the right personality?

Evidence shows that networking is the # 1 way to accomplish business goals. Just ask your association CEO or executive director! Chances are they will tell you that networking is typically the best way to find and build effective business relationships. Part of successful career mapping is networking and building relationships.

Bring your lunch and improve your networking ability!

In a creative, fun, 4-step process you will transfer your natural skills and success from an activity you love to networking.

Speaker:  Gail Sussman Miller founded Inspired Choice to work primarily with women solopreneurs to teach them how to love business obstacles and overcome them with ease.  Gail uses networking to build her business, invitations to deliver workshops, write articles, get media placements and to attract clients.  She offers obstacle-busting workshops and tele-classes like How to Love Networking (Speaking, Selling) for individuals and groups.

Gail is a reformed clutterer, a recovering perfectionist and calls herself a "mid-life bloomer" Baby Boomer. After years of waiting to feel inspired, or confident enough, or ready, or good enough, she found her true passion in work, marriage, motherhood and life all after the age of 44!  Now she helps others to stop waiting by getting really clear about what they truly want, reframing "yes, but" thinking, making inspired choices and taking action.
